Im not sure if you fixed your problem yet or not man Im new to the fourms. but i have the same truck and last year i done a complete flush on mine and was having the same problem, if you changed you water pump or anything to lose antifreeze then your probly airlocked. run your engine with the cover off the coolant bottle keeping an eye on the temp gauge this should work. let me know how it turned out
